Meander through the tideline with Deb Henley.  The artists original acrylic paintings on canvas were recently inspired by the colours and patterns of the local marine life that lives, grows or comes to rest on the shores of Safety Cove & Crooked Billet Bay
.
As Deb explores the coastline, her encounters with windows into the tidal realm draw her into deep observation
.
Her collages of marine species entwined within the rocky shoreline are the artistic outcome of Deb’s personal enquiry, looking deeper, studying the movement, colour, sound, behaviour and natural beauty of the coastal nooks, surrounding her home at White Beach on the Tasman Peninsula
.
Deb Henley received the Tasman Council Acquisition Award and People’s Choice Award at the 2024 Tasman Art & Craft Fair.  Her work has also been recently featured in 'Nature' journal, depicting the artists interpretation of coral bleaching on The Great Barrier Reef.
